[Preparation of Kikubayama Bo Chi extract]
A general method for preparing an extract from plant raw materials can be employed as appropriate, but a solvent extraction method is desirable. For solvent extraction, it is desirable to use a polar solvent such as water or ethanol, and it is more desirable to use water and another polar solvent simultaneously. Furthermore, the extract can be separated and purified by activated carbon treatment, liquid-liquid distribution, column chromatography, liquid chromatography, gel filtration, etc., and a fraction (component) with higher activity can be extracted.

As described above, the DPPH radical scavenging effect was observed in Kikubayama box extract.

上記の通り、キクバヤマボクチエキスのUVBに起因する炎症関連分子であるTNF−α遺伝子の発現抑制効果が認められる
As described above, the effect of suppressing the expression of the TNF-α gene, which is an inflammation-related molecule caused by UVB of Kikubayama boxy extract, is observed .

得られたdot-blotting(図1)を解析した結果、上記の通り、キクバヤマボクチエキスのglyoxalに起因するAGEs形成の抑制効果が認められた。
As a result of analysis of the obtained dot-blotting (FIG. 1), as described above, an inhibitory effect on the formation of AGEs due to glyoxal of the kikubayama boxy extract was observed.

上記の通り、キクバヤマボクチエキスの保湿効果が認められた。
As described above, the moisturizing effect of Kikubayama Box extract was recognized.

上記の通り、天然保湿因子NMFの増加によるバリア機能が向上の指標となるclaudin-1(CLDN1)およびfilaggrin(FLG)の増加が認められた。
As described above, an increase in claudin-1 (CLDN1) and filaggrin (FLG), which are indicators for improving the barrier function due to an increase in natural moisturizing factor NMF, was observed.

得られたdot-blotting(図2)を解析した結果、上記の通り、UVB起因する皮膚老化度合の指標である変性タンパク質の一種4-HNEMPの形成抑制効果が認められた。
As a result of analyzing the obtained dot-blotting (FIG. 2), an effect of inhibiting formation of 4-HNEMP, a kind of denatured protein, which is an index of the degree of skin aging caused by UVB was observed as described above.
